Guide to the long-lasting car battery life

The car battery is the powerhouse of the car. The moment a car battery fails, it becomes non-functional and non-existent. The efficient functionality of the car aids in seamless functioning and provides it with the initial momentum. Like any other spare- part of the car, the batteries wear down with time. Hence require replacements. But what are the key -points to keep in mind before choosing a car battery?

The following checkpoints must be ticked- off the list before finalizing.

1) Determine the Car battery size

The first and foremost thing before finalizing the car battery is to determine the car battery size. As car batteries come in different shapes and sizes, thus it is essential to see the one that perfectly matches the car's requirements. For further clarification, refer to the owner's car manual to see the exact specification.

2) Choose the brand

While choosing the car battery, the owner must choose the battery brand suggested in their car manual. And the car owner not be tempted by the low-price copies of product batteries. They may seem cheaper for the moment, but not in the long run, as not investing in a good product results in investing in their high maintenance and low performance.

3) Check the car battery manufacturing date and its reserve capacity.

Before finalizing and choosing the car battery, check the car's battery manufacturing date for its long life and also check the reserve capacity of the car's battery. To select the ideal reserve capacity of the car battery, the owner must refer to the car manual to finalize the car battery with the required reserve capacity.    

With the above-given points in mind, one must select an ideal car battery that performs better in the long run.

The above points were for choosing the new ideal car battery, but how can one look out for the car-battery malfunctioning signals in the car battery?

Here are the following malfunctioning signals in the car:

1) Dim Car-headlights

If lately, you are encountering dim car headlights often, it might be due to your car-battery malfunctioning. Car headlights that are dimmer than usual indicate it's time to replace the car battery, as it can be a safety issue at night.

2)Unusual sound when you turn on the ignition

Lately, when you turn on the ignition of the vehicle, you hear an unusual noise. It might be due to the poor performance of the battery and the inability to provide sufficient battery.

3) Cranking sound from the engine

Lately, while driving, if you have noticed an unusual cracking sound from the engine, its performance also appears sluggish. The danger of detecting car battery health not be missed, and visit the nearest service station.

4) Random Sparks

The deteriorating health of the car battery may result in uneven sparks. These freq?uent sparks may be due to the fuel accumulation in the cylinders. When this accumulated fuel inside the cylinders ignites, it results in random sparks. Hence, when you encounter such a situation, get your vehicle evaluated at the nearby service station.

If you have been experiencing any of the above symptoms while driving, get your car battery re-evaluated at the nearest service station. At the service station, experienced professionals examine your vehicle and suggest necessary advice.
